The brief

Highsted Grammar School is an 11-18 selective girls’ school in Sittingbourne, Kent.

Currently the school is four form entry school with a PAN of 120.

In 2010 the school converted to Academy status.

The school’s most recent Ofsted report confirms that the school is outstanding in all areas; outcomes for children are excellent and the school seeks to be outstanding all that it endeavours.

Consequently, the environment that pupils and staff work within needs to reflect the ambitious values of the school and be in-keeping with the high expectations for an effective, high performing environment.

The school seeks to ensure that it achieves best value from all engaged in the pursuit of delivering quality outcomes for children.

The tender project is seeking to appoint a contractor whose initiative and innovation will be welcomed for the provision of service – cleaning - within the existing facilities for the 799 pupils and 96 teaching and support staff, to ensure that the cleanliness of the accommodation meets health and safety regulations in addition to supporting the delivery of quality education and upholding staff/pupil well-being.

The contract being tendered is for three years in duration from 1st September 2026 and will operate as a Guaranteed Performance Contract, with the successful contractor offering the school a guaranteed return /cost per annum for the provision of cleaning services.

The school year is based on a calendar of 195 days.

Five days are to be used for staff professional development which means that the school will be open to receive pupils for the legal minimum of 190 days.
